Description

PingWind in partnership with Clear Creek Federal is seeking a highly qualified Collective Training Subject Matter Expert (SME) to support an opportunity with the Department of War. The SME will provide expert collective training support to the Military Intelligence Readiness Command (MIRC) Headquarters in the development management coordination execution and assessment of collective training programs for Army Reserve Intelligence forces.

This position supports intelligence readiness across multiple disciplines including Geospatial Intelligence (GEOINT) All-Source Intelligence Signals Intelligence (SIGINT) Human Intelligence (HUMINT) and Counterintelligence (CI). The successful candidate will work closely with Geographic and Functional Commands (GFC) Army Reserve Intelligence units and other stakeholders to ensure training programs align with Army doctrine operational requirements and readiness objectives.
